The Senior IT Manager – Data, Integration & Advanced Analytics is a strategic people leader responsible for defining vision, leading portfolios, enabling innovation, and delivering business value through enterprise data, integration, analytics, and AI capabilities. This role will focus on organizational leadership, strategy execution, stakeholder management, governance, and talent development while partnering with business and technology teams to accelerate Medtronic's digital transformation. CAREERS THAT CHANGE LIVES Data, Integration & Analytics Strategy LeadershipDefine and execute enterprise strategies for Data, Integration, Analytics, and AI capabilities aligned with business objectives and enterprise architecture. Develop and maintain multi-year roadmaps that advance data modernization, analytics transformation, AI adoption, and integration capabilities. Identify strategic opportunities to improve business outcomes through data-driven decision making and intelligent automation. Partner with business and technology leaders to align investments with enterprise priorities and long-term growth objectives. Portfolio & Delivery LeadershipLead a portfolio of enterprise data, integration, analytics, and AI initiatives from concept through value realization. Establish prioritization frameworks, governance processes, and delivery models that maximize business value. Drive program execution, risk management, resource planning, and executive reporting across strategic initiatives. Ensure initiatives are delivered successfully while meeting business objectives, quality standards, and financial targets. Business & Stakeholder PartnershipServe as a trusted advisor to senior business and technology leaders. Translate business priorities into technology and analytics strategies that drive measurable outcomes. Build strong partnerships across Commercial, Operations, Supply Chain, Finance, Quality, Manufacturing, and R&D organizations. Communicate vision, strategy, progress, and business value to executive stakeholders. Governance, Architecture & QualityEstablish governance frameworks that ensure scalable, secure, compliant, and reusable enterprise solutions. Drive adherence to enterprise architecture principles, data governance standards, privacy requirements, and regulatory expectations. Promote consistency, standardization, and reuse across enterprise data and integration ecosystems. Define and monitor key performance indicators that measure business value, adoption, solution quality, and delivery effectiveness. Advanced Analytics & AI LeadershipDrive enterprise adoption of advanced analytics, AI, machine learning, and intelligent decision-support capabilities. Identify and prioritize high-value opportunities that leverage analytics and AI to improve business performance. Enable development of modern data products, semantic layers, self-service analytics, and conversational intelligence solutions. Foster innovation through emerging technologies and industry-leading practices. People & Organizational LeadershipLead and develop high-performing global teams consisting of employees, contractors, and strategic partners. Create a culture of accountability, innovation, collaboration, and continuous improvement. Mentor leaders and team members to strengthen technical, business, and leadership capabilities. Develop workforce strategies, succession plans, and talent pipelines to support future organizational needs. Establish organizational goals and objectives aligned with broader business and technology strategies. Champion inclusion, diversity, equity, and employee engagement across the organization. Financial & Vendor LeadershipSupport portfolio planning, budgeting, investment prioritization, and financial management activities. Partner with strategic vendors and technology providers to enable successful execution of business objectives. Drive cost optimization and value realization across technology investments and initiatives. MUST HAVE (Minimum Qualifications) 7+ years of experience with a bachelor’s degree or 5+ years of experience with an advanced degree 5+ years of managerial experience NICE TO HAVE (Preferred Qualifications) Bachelor's or Advanced Deg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Data Analytics, Engineering, Business, or a related field. 10+ years of experience in Data, Analytics, Integration, AI, or Digital Technology leadership roles. 5+ years leading large global teams, managers, and complex strategic programs. Experience delivering enterprise data platforms, integration ecosystems, analytics solutions, and AI initiatives. Knowledge of modern cloud data, analytics, AI, and integration technologies. Experience in MedTech, Healthcare, Life Sciences, or other regulated industries. Strong track record of building strategic partnerships and influencing senior leaders. Proven ability to drive business transformation through data and analytics. Strong communication, organizational leadership, financial management, and stakeholder management skills. Master's Degree or leadership-focused certifications preferred.
